摘  要:In this paper,the consensus problem is investigated for discrete-time multi-agent systems with additive process noises.Due to the presence of additive noises in the system dynamics,consensus cannot be achieved.The main contribution of this paper is to give the exact consensus error.In particular,control gain depending on the agent dynamics and network topology is designed based on the technique dealing with the simultaneous stabilization.Finally,a numerical simulation is provided to demonstrate the effectiveness of the proposed theoretical results.
